3 Setting up “Teacher” Accounts Edmodo was created for schools – 4-H leaders/volunteers enroll as “teachers”; 4-Hers as “students” – Everyone belongs to “districts, groups” This screencast is based on Snohomish County, WA, if you live elsewhere, you will want to work with your RB Administrator to retrieve the proper codes. – In the meantime, feel free to temporarily join the Snohomish County, WA “district” and use the codes for RB Training: 4f8x52 Permanent RB training: xy3j3i The Edmodo program locks/changes these on a regular basis.

10 When you first join you will be a “teacher” with read-only privileges. Interacting with youth on their RB assignments requires “co- teacher” privileges. The group’s owner (ideally, your RB Admin) can give you this “promotion.” Joining Groups

12 Record Booking The 4-H Record Book (RB) is completed through a series of assignments. Find them under the heartbeat at the top of your Edmodo screen. Scroll to the bottom of the assignments to complete the first: The“4-H Introduction.”

13 RB Assignments Assignments in the RB 4-H Introduction 3 SMART goals (required) 9 optional SMART goals Quarterly financial updates Monthly quiz- updates

14 Coaching a SMART goal to mastery This young 4-Her wrote an appropriate 4-H goal that does not meet the SMART qualities. The leaders’ challenges is to help the her make it SMART.

15 Coaching a SMART goal to mastery You can lead 4- Hers to goals with SMART qualities through age/development ally appropriate conversation and questions. This also contributes to a sense of belonging.

16 Coaching a SMART goal to mastery Depending on the age/development al stage of the youth, you may ask them to put all the elements into a single, SMART goal. Or not.

17 Scoring/Evaluation Leaders may revise assignment scores after it is revised by the 4- Her. Moticons and badges are also motivating ways to provide feedback on RB assignments and other 4-H involvements.

19 RBing: Monthly Updates Monthly quizzes remind 4-Hers of four things you should do each month: Updating SMART goals Changing goals Updating financial records Adding pictures or interacting with others on the wall Find each month’s quiz on the wall by scrolling down.
